Tinazzi Ca' de' Rocchi Istà Pinot Grigio delle Venezie 2025, Italy
Tinazzi Ca' de' Rocchi Istà Pinot Grigio delle Venezie 2025 is a crisp white wine from Veneto, made from 100% Pinot Grigio. The grapes are harvested in the first 10 days of September and then fermented cool to keep the fruity character crisp and clean. With notes of pear, peach, white flowers and a soft, fresh taste, this is an approachable Italian white wine for aperitifs, fish and light pasta dishes.
Vineyards and region
The grapes come from suitable vineyards in Veneto, within the Pinot Grigio delle Venezie DOP appellation.
• Location / Origin: Veneto is located in Northeast Italy and is an important region for fresh white wines. Within Pinot Grigio delle Venezie DOP, the style revolves around clear fruit, fresh acidity and a light, elegant structure.
• Classification: Pinot Grigio delle Venezie DOP is a protected designation of origin for Pinot Grigio from Northeast Italy. This DOP status gives the wine a clearly defined origin and recognizable style.
• Vineyard & harvest: The grapes are harvested when perfectly ripe, during the first 10 days of September. This early harvest helps to preserve freshness, citrus tension and aromatic purity.
• Wine style: This Istà is made as a fresh, approachable Pinot Grigio with a light color, fruity aroma and soft finish. This makes the wine suitable for aperitifs and light dishes.
Vinification and aging
The vinification focuses on freshness, pure fruit and an elegant, soft taste.
• Grape processing: The grapes are destemmed and crushed, followed by a gentle pressing. This keeps the juice clean and fruity, without harsh extraction from the skins.
• Fermentation: Fermentation takes place at a controlled temperature of 14–18 °C. This cool approach helps to keep aromas of pear, peach and white flowers clear.
• Aging: The wine is aged in stainless steel. This keeps the style fresh, pure and direct, with an emphasis on fruit and drinkability.
• Technical balance: With 12.5% alcohol, 5.50 g/l acidity and 5.4 g/l residual sugar, this Pinot Grigio remains light, fresh and smoothly balanced.
Grape composition
This white wine from Veneto is made entirely from Pinot Grigio.
• 100% Pinot Grigio – Pinot Grigio delle Venezie DOP: Pinot Grigio gives this wine its straw yellow color, fresh fruit notes, soft structure and approachable style. The grape is known for light, elegant white wines that work particularly well as an aperitif or with refined dishes.
Tasting notes and serving suggestions
Straw yellow in the glass with green reflections, followed by aromas of pear, peach and white flowers. The taste is fresh, elegant and soft, with a smooth structure and a light fruity finish.
• Serving temperature: Serve Tinazzi Ca' de' Rocchi Istà Pinot Grigio delle Venezie 2025 at 8–10 °C, so that the fruit and fresh acidity remain beautifully crisp.
• Dishes: Serve with antipasti, light pasta, grilled fish, shellfish, fresh salads, vegetarian dishes or as an aperitif.
More information about Tinazzi Ca' de' Rocchi
Ca' de' Rocchi is a line from Tinazzi that focuses on fresh, accessible wines with a modern style. The wines are made with indigenous yeasts naturally present on the grape skins, giving each harvest its own character. Tinazzi was founded in 1968 in Cavaion Veronese and has a strong base in Veneto, with the purchase of Tenuta Valleselle in Bardolino in 1986 as an important moment in the family's history.
